Basidiomycetes, order Aphyllosteganales, family Polyporaceae. It grows on dead branches of broad-leaved trees. The cap lacks a stalk and is semicircular or fan-shaped, 3-10 cm in diameter. It is leathery or corky, with thin flesh and about 3-5 mm thick. It is bright scarlet in color, similar to a mushroom. This fungus is tropical and is widely distributed from the tropics to temperate zones. It is a harmful fungus that causes white rot on useful wood.
